Jarmari Lewis Irvin appeals from the adjudication of his guilt for aggravated assault with
a deadly weapon and possession of cocaine in an amount less than one gram. See TEX. PENAL
CODE ANN. § 22.02(a) (West 2011); TEX. HEALTH & SAFETY CODE ANN. § 481.115(a), (b) (2010). The trial court assessed punishment at five years imprisonment on the aggravated
assault conviction and two years’ confinement in a state jail facility on the possession of cocaine
conviction. On appeal. appellants attorney filed a brief in which he concludes the appeals are
wholly frivolous and without merit. The brief meets the requirements of ilnders v. Call/am/a.
386 U S 738 (1967) the brief presents a piolessional evaluation of the iecord showing why in eltect. there are no arguable grounds to advance. cc high ta1c. 573 S.W.2d 807. 811 (Vex.
Crim. App. I Panel Op. j I 978). (ounsel delivered a copy of the hriei to appellant. We advised
appellant ol his right to Ole a pro se response, but he did not file a iro se response.
We have reviewed the record and counsel’s brief Se B/ecLsoe v State, 178 S.W.3d 824,
827 (Tex. Crim. App. 2005) (explaining appellate court’s duty in Anders cases). We agree the
appeals are frivolous and without merit. We find nothing in the record that might arguably
support the appeals.
We affirm the trial courts judgments.
